To believe The Team, Jonathan Claus would have a clear position on its future: not to pack upOlympic Marseille this winter. And this, although the leaders of OM would not be satisfied with its performance in recent weeks, publicly calling into question its investment in an indirect manner as did Pablo Longoria at a press conference on Monday. The president of OM thanked Geoffrey Kondogbia, Jeans Onana And Jordan Veretout for having made the necessary sacrifices againstAS Monaco last Saturday (2-2) despite not being in optimal form when Jonathan Claus came out during the game.
